Easement Land Clearing in Salt Lake City, UT
Easement land clearing services involve removing trees, brush, and other vegetation from designated areas on a property to create clear access or meet specific land use needs. These projects often include preparing pathways for utility lines, access roads, drainage improvements, or future construction. Property owners typically seek this service to ensure safe and unobstructed access to utility easements, to maintain property safety, or to comply with local regulations. Understanding the scope of the clearing, including the types of vegetation involved and the extent of the area, is essential before requesting services.
Before requesting easement land clearing, property owners should consider the size and boundaries of the area to be cleared, as well as any restrictions or regulations related to vegetation removal in the local area. It’s also helpful to determine whether any protected trees or environmentally sensitive areas are involved, as these may require special considerations. Clear communication about project goals and the specific land use plans can help ensure the work meets expectations and adheres to local guidelines.

Easement Land Clearing Questions
What is easement land clearing? Easement land clearing involves removing trees, brush, and obstacles within a designated area to access or maintain utility lines, pipelines, or other infrastructure on a property.
Why might property owners need easement land clearing? Clearing is often required to ensure safe and reliable access for utility maintenance, prevent overgrowth, or prepare land for future development within an easement.
What types of projects require easement land clearing? Projects include utility line access, pipeline maintenance, drainage improvements, and access roads within designated easement areas.
What should property owners consider before clearing an easement? It's important to identify property boundaries, understand easement rights, and plan for any restrictions or regulations related to the clearing process.
